19th "Chinese Bridge" Chinese Proficiency Competition for Foreign Secondary School Students in India
To promote cultural exchange between China and India, encourage Indian teenagers’ interest in learning Chinese, and deepen their understanding of the Chinese language and culture, the Chinese Embassy in India will host the 19th “Chinese Bridge” Chinese Proficiency Competition for Foreign Secondary School Students (India, 2026). Age & Status: Current secondary school students in India, aged 12–18.
Nationality: Must hold Indian nationality and have grown up in India.
Language Background: Both applicants and parents must be non-native Chinese speakers.
Exclusion: Finalists of the previous global competition are, in principle, not eligible to participate for two consecutive sessions.
3.1 Online Pre-Selection (To select finalists)
Chinese Poetry Recitation : Any Chinese poem you choose (within 5 minutes) via Zoom (see date below).
Cultural Talent Video: Pre-submit a video showcasing skills such as Chinese song/dance, traditional instruments, opera, calligraphy, painting, or martial arts.
3.2 Offline Final & Award Ceremony (To select Global Finalists)
Theme Speech: A 5-minute on-site speech titled by the student under the theme: "Chinese, Joy & Fun!"
Cultural Performance: Live showcase of Chinese arts and skills.

Finalist Support: The top 3 contestants from the preliminary round will advance to the finals. The committee will provide round-trip airfare, accommodation, and meals for out-of-town finalists.
Certificates & Prizes: Winners of the First, Second, and Third prizes in the final round will receive official certificates and prizes. All preliminary participants will receive commemorative gifts.
Global Finals: The First Prize winner will be recommended to represent India in the Global Final Competition in China.
Scholarship Priority: All award-winning contestants will receive priority consideration for scholarships to study in China.
